The steps in creating the car image
During a wedding, the day takes on a momentum all it's own. As a photographer you can nudge, bend and use the momentum, but you can't expect to control it. Wedding momentum is like a wild bull. If you try and grab it by the horns to get it to submit to your will, you'll soon find you've frustrated either the bride or yourself. Every wedding photographer knows that it is easier to live in the chaos, than to try to control it point for point—and that's where vision comes into play.

For example, let's take the image above. The happy couple has just run out of their reception hall and has been pelted with bubbles. They're on a fast track to their getaway car, where they'll wave goodbye, kiss one last time and disappear into wedded bliss. All this happens in a few short minutes and then the wedding is over. this is where our vision kicks in...

The story
It was night, and the bride and groom were dancing. We had captured all the various ways you can shoot dancing images, and were waiting for the last dance to start. Michelle and I saw their getaway car outside and started to plan what shots we were going to get for their exit. We quickly studied the angles, where people would stand, what our location would be, and all that good stuff. Ending up at the car, we decided to capture their final kiss in a dramatic fashion. It was dark by this time, and the inside of the car would be completely black. We grabbed a flash, hooked up some wireless gear, and tested the settings we'd need, so we could quickly capture the shot we needed before their send off. Memorizing the settings, we went back inside, shot their final dance, captured their exit, and quickly set the flash to what we knew the light needed to be. All this work and forethought paid off as we captured an amazing image filled with mood and drama in a night setting. the difference is our vision; our planning This is what you are paying for! Technical knowhow with forethought is much more powerful than technical knowhow on it's own.
